端口复用和重映射--STM32F103
生活随笔
收集整理的這篇文章主要介紹了
端口复用和重映射--STM32F103
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
什么是端口復用?
STM32中有很多內置外設,這些外設的引腳都是與GPIO復用的,什么時候復用呢?就是當一個GPIO作為內置外設引腳使用時,就叫做復用。比如串口1的發送接收引腳是PA9,PA10,當PA9,PA10作為USART的接收和發送引腳時,就是端口復用。
端口復用的配置過程
以PA9、PA10作為串口的接收發送為例
這里我們可以參考STM32手冊
參考STM32手冊
端口復用總結
每個GPIO口有很多功能,默認的是作為普通IO口,我們不用配置復用相關的東西,當作為其他功能時,這個時候就要配置復用相關代碼了
端口重映射
什么是端口重映射?
端口重映射是為了使不同器件封裝的外設I/O功能達到最優,可以把一些復用功能重新映射到其他一些引腳。當映射完成時,復用功能就不在映射到它們的原始引腳上了。
配置過程
總結
以上是生活随笔為你收集整理的端口复用和重映射--STM32F103的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 我狂战鬼泣、漫游、散打柔道、战法元素、圣
- 下一篇: 外部中断---STM32F1